计算机系统软件是指 管理和控制计算机硬件与软件资源的程序集合,是计算机系统的基础和核心。它包括操作系统、语言处理程序、数据库管理系统等。系统软件的主要功能包括:
操作系统:
如Windows、macOS等,协调各硬件工作并提供操作界面。
语言处理程序:
将程序代码转换为机器语言。
数据库管理系统:
用于管理数据。
实用工具:
辅助性的软件,用于系统维护、优化和管理,例如搜索程序、存储管理程序、备份程序、杀毒程序、故障排除工具和虚拟助手等。
驱动程序:
与计算机硬件设备通信的特殊软件,用于识别硬件、接收并解释来自操作系统的指令,管理计算机资源以确保硬件设备正常工作。
编译器和解释器:
将高级语言编写的源代码转换为计算机能够直接执行的机器代码。
系统软件使计算机用户和其他软件将计算机视为一个整体,而无需关注底层硬件的具体工作原理。它是用户与计算机硬件之间的接口,提供控制和管理计算机资源的功能。